Just when we thought the Logitech Superstrike couldn’t get any better, a massive leak on Amazon has revealed some seriously exciting details about the upcoming X3 model. While rumors of a new Superstrike have been circulating since July, this latest information paints a clear picture of what to expect from Logitech’s next-generation gaming mouse.

A New Era for Rapid Trigger Technology

The original Logitech Superstrike was already a game-changer thanks to its innovative HITS (High-Speed Induction Trigger System). This technology allows players to customize the actuation point, effectively reducing latency and giving them a competitive edge. The leaked information suggests that the X3 will build upon this foundation with further refinements to the HITS system.

A close-up shot of the Logitech X3 Superstrike gaming mouse, showcasing its sleek design and customizable buttons.

The leak confirms previous rumors about two color options: a stealthy all-black model and a vibrant pink-and-black variant. But the real headliner is the reported 50% increase in battery life, bringing it up to an impressive 135 hours from the original’s 90 hours at 1,000 Hz polling. This extended battery life will be a huge boon for gamers who spend long hours in intense matches.

Refined Design and Enhanced Performance

Beyond the battery boost, the X3 Superstrike is also said to feature an upgraded sensor with an additional 4,000 DPI, bringing the total up to 48,000. This increased sensitivity will allow for even more precise tracking and control. The leak also mentions “refined weight and balance,” addressing a common complaint about the original X2 model, which some users found to be too front-heavy.
